Tuberculosis in heart is extremely rare and not many cases are reported. It infects heart by haematogenous spread from other organs. Diagnosis is generally made on autopsy as there are no direct investigations to diagnose ante partum. A case of 20 year old female with history of assault, post mortem viscera were sent for histopathological examination. On histopathology numerous organs showed caseous necrosis. Heart sections showed granulomatous lesions and diagnosis of tuberculosis was rendered. We present this case due to its rarity and to differentiate it from other granulomatous pathology of heart.
